Tailing vacuum dewatering filter disc
Vacuum ceramic filter machine are widely used in tailings dewatering due to their advantages such as high efficiency, energy conservation and low moisture content. As the core component of vacuum ceramic filter machine, the performance of vacuum ceramic filter disc directly determines the dewatering efficiency, operating cost and maintenance intensity of the entire machine. Compared with traditional filter cloths (such as those used in vacuum disc and belt filters), vacuum ceramic filter disc with their unique materials and structures, have demonstrated significant product advantages in the field of tailings and various mineral dewatering.
Ultra-high filtration accuracy and extremely low moisture content in the filter cake

Advantage essence: Vacuum ceramic filter disc are composed of uniform micro-porous ceramic materials (such as alumina, silicon carbide), and the micro-pore diameters are controllable (commonly 1.5μm, 2μm, 5μm, etc.).
Specific manifestations
The filter cake is drier: It can form a denser filter cake with a lower porosity, and the moisture content of the filter cake is usually 5% to 15% lower than that of traditional filter cloth filters. For instance, the moisture content of iron ore tailings filter cakes can reach 10% to 15%, and that of copper ore tailings can reach 12% to 18%.
The filtrate is clear: The micropores can effectively intercept ultrafine particles, making the filtrate extremely clear (with low turbidity), and the solid content is usually less than 5 ppm (mg/L). It can be directly reused as process water in the beneficiation plant, significantly reducing the consumption of fresh water and the cost of wastewater treatment.
No penetration and turbidity: Under the appropriate selection of pore size, the phenomenon of fine particles penetrating almost never occurs, ensuring stable filtration quality.
Outstanding energy-saving effect (low operating cost)

Advantage essence: Utilizing the principle of capillary action, it does not require continuous high vacuum suction.
Specific manifestations
The power consumption of the vacuum pump is extremely low: a high vacuum degree is only required when the initial filter cake layer is formed. Once the filter cake is formed, only a low vacuum degree needs to be maintained (capillary water suction), and the power of the vacuum pump is only 10%-30% of that of traditional vacuum filters.
No compressed air consumption: Unlike some filter presses, it does not require high-pressure air to dry the filter cake.
The comprehensive energy consumption has been significantly reduced: It is recognized as one of the most energy-efficient solid-liquid separation devices.
Ultra-long service life and low maintenance cost
The essential advantage: Ceramic material has extremely high physical and chemical stability.
Specific manifestations
Extra-long lifespan: Under correct usage and maintenance, the service life of ceramic filter plates can typically reach 12 to 13 months or even longer, which is much longer than that of filter cloths (whose lifespan is usually only a few weeks to a few months).
Wear-resistant and corrosion-resistant: High hardness (Mohs hardness ≥8), resistant to particle erosion and wear; Resistant to strong acids (except hydrofluoric acid and hot concentrated alkali), resistant to corrosion by most chemical agents, and suitable for complex pulp environments.
No consumable replacement cost: It eliminates the huge expenses and downtime caused by frequent filter cloth replacement.
Simple maintenance: The main maintenance work is regular cleaning (backwashing, acid washing, ultrasonic cleaning), without the need for frequent disassembly, replacement or sewing like filter cloth.
High filtration efficiency and stable production capacity

Essential advantages: Large microporous flux, not prone to clogging (easy to regenerate), and fast dehydration speed.
Specific manifestations
High processing capacity per unit area: Under the applicable material conditions (as mentioned earlier), the processing volume per unit area is usually better than or equivalent to that of traditional vacuum filters.
Continuous and stable operation: Through effective backwashing and combined cleaning (acid washing + ultrasonic), it can continuously maintain high porosity and flux, avoid a sharp decline in production capacity caused by clogging, and ensure long-term stable operation.
High degree of automation: It is easy to integrate into an automatic control system to achieve unattended operation or remote monitoring.
Outstanding environmental protection and sustainability
Essential advantages: Highly efficient water conservation and no secondary solid waste.
Specific manifestations
Significantly increase the return water rate: The clear filtrate is directly reused, significantly reducing the amount of fresh water taken from the concentrator and the discharge of wastewater.
Reduce solid waste disposal: Drier filter cakes reduce the volume/weight of transportation and storage, lowering the pressure on tailings pond capacity and disposal costs.
No filter cloth waste: It eliminates the environmental pollution problem caused by a large amount of waste filter cloth (usually classified as hazardous waste or difficult to degrade).
Reducing carbon emissions: Energy conservation itself means reducing carbon emissions.

Process adaptability and flexibility
The essential advantage: It can adapt to different materials by choosing ceramic plates with different hole diameters and materials.
Specific manifestations
Optional pore size: Select the optimal pore size (1.5μm, 2μm, 5μm, etc.) based on the particle size of the material to balance the dehydration speed and accuracy.
Material options include: such as alumina, silicon carbide, etc., to meet the requirements of different chemical environments (acid/alkali) and wear resistance.
Capable of handling fine-grained materials: Particularly skilled in processing fine-grained and difficult-to-settle materials that are hard to filter efficiently with traditional filter cloths.
